Summary

New Summerfield School is an alternative public school serving grades PK-12 in the New Summerfield Independent School District, with 511 students enrolled. The school has consistently maintained a 100% four-year graduation rate and very low dropout rates, ranging from 0-0.4% in recent years.

New Summerfield School stands out for its exceptional graduation and low dropout rates, as well as its strong performance on STAAR reading assessments, where proficiency rates often exceed the state average by 10-20 percentage points. However, the school's math proficiency rates are more mixed, with some grades performing well above the state average but others struggling to match state-level performance. Compared to nearby alternative schools like Laneville School and Compass Center, New Summerfield serves a larger student population and has higher graduation and lower dropout rates, suggesting it may have more robust support systems in place.

With 81-87% of students qualifying for free or reduced-price lunch, New Summerfield School serves a much higher proportion of economically disadvantaged students compared to the state average. The school's spending of around $12,000 per student annually may contribute to its strong performance in certain areas, though the uneven math results indicate an opportunity to strengthen its math curriculum and teaching practices.
